In today's digital age, securing user data is more critical than ever. As cyber threats evolve, so must the strategies and skills of web developers. The Advanced Certificate in Secure Web Development is designed to equip professionals with the latest tools and knowledge to protect user data effectively. Let's dive into the cutting-edge trends, innovations, and future developments that make this certificate a game-changer.
The Evolving Landscape of Web Security
The digital landscape is constantly shifting, and with it, the threats to web security. Traditional methods of securing data are no longer sufficient. Modern web applications need to be resilient against a wide array of attacks, from SQL injection to cross-site scripting (XSS) and beyond. The Advanced Certificate in Secure Web Development focuses on these emerging threats, providing a comprehensive understanding of how to mitigate risks.
One of the standout features of this certificate is its emphasis on the latest security frameworks and tools. Developers learn to implement cutting-edge technologies such as Web Application Firewalls (WAFs) and Security Information and Event Management (SIEM) systems. These tools offer real-time monitoring and response capabilities, ensuring that any potential breaches are detected and addressed promptly.
Innovations in Secure Coding Practices
Secure coding practices are at the heart of the Advanced Certificate in Secure Web Development. This program delves into the latest innovations in coding techniques that minimize vulnerabilities. For instance, developers learn about the principles of secure design patterns, which help in creating applications that are inherently secure.
Another key innovation is the integration of automated security testing tools. These tools can scan code for vulnerabilities in real-time, providing immediate feedback to developers. This not only speeds up the development process but also ensures that security is baked into the application from the outset. Additionally, the program covers the latest trends in secure API design, emphasizing the importance of authentication and authorization mechanisms to protect sensitive data.
The Role of AI and Machine Learning in Web Security
Artificial Intelligence (AI) and Machine Learning (ML) are transforming the field of web security. The Advanced Certificate in Secure Web Development incorporates these technologies to enhance the ability to detect and respond to threats. AI-powered systems can analyze vast amounts of data to identify unusual patterns that may indicate a security breach. This proactive approach allows for quicker detection and mitigation of potential threats.
Moreover, ML algorithms can be trained to adapt to new types of attacks, making them an invaluable tool in the fight against cybercrime. The certificate program provides hands-on experience with AI and ML tools, enabling developers to leverage these technologies effectively in their web applications. This forward-thinking approach ensures that graduates are well-prepared to tackle the security challenges of the future.
Future Developments and Staying Ahead of the Curve
The field of web security is dynamic, and staying ahead of the curve is essential. The Advanced Certificate in Secure Web Development is designed with future developments in mind. The curriculum includes modules on emerging technologies such as blockchain and quantum computing, which are poised to revolutionize data security.
Blockchain, for instance, offers a decentralized and immutable ledger that can be used to secure transactions and data. Quantum computing, on the other hand, presents both challenges and opportunities for web security. Understanding these technologies and their potential impact on web applications is crucial for future-proofing security strategies.
Conclusion
The Advanced Certificate in Secure Web Development is more than just a certificate; it's a pathway to becoming a leader in web security. By focusing on the latest trends, innovations, and future developments, this program equips developers with the skills and knowledge needed to protect user data in an ever-evolving digital landscape. Whether you're a seasoned developer or just starting your career, this certificate offers a comprehensive and forward-thinking approach to securing web applications.
In a world where data breaches can have devastating consequences, investing in secure web development is not just a smart move—it's